Type
ORACLE
Validation date
2024-05-30 05:59: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01937,
    "usd": 0.02091
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BD32A46E180E1535768EBAF9266FE6F9A259EEF9FE95270D998AA9B45D7977E6

Previous signature

6667BD482F11DC2B089D98EA8F22E645C555DC51B3394E23714A7D2E76C0D2AE9E4A8A8F10B2D9157EC8271D869E9F806FCAA885C732DEB0FFF3B80692812E04

Origin signature

3046022100BDB94B8E5054A5C44441CC09347FE594BC55BD684266A75576FFE4EFFA6EA62E0221008BB0CB9A4A6B5CCDE26849A95AC5AAEBC8CA44F78145ADDBC78E443DFFD19727

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

00AF36F832C7A3DC7A988067ACEDC34E9D9BE54D5810293CADD2BBBCA6E630EEFB

Coordinator signature

364FED1E5A2DEAF29D13DD90FFD6CDB47879F1002CC76CF9901C27B3166EA0AC5E69A2BD9F40917918CAD7EA6BFA890CFB15286AC5817D86F284471B930B7E04

Validator #1 public key

000103E30584AD8DE66F9E29419D5D0ABEE5A76722C9FD0D012BDDE3A6E2B149C48D

Validator #1 signature

63B8F06C042F4401C1E17C51A914F9B913BFE050B116C91251A9679EA11DAFF69527BA26251F61FBD920E0F45B17E296560FC049646191F4A3A72D117AA03C05

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

7B7887782DD32445136D3A5A3339F195D4DFFAD94A1C31ED1F80454959D66B9CC9D41B6AE5063FBD924DFB933C6EE6A04485E0EE46B08B19D640A92131DDAB09